La cryptanalyse est la science mathématique qui s’occupe de l’analyse d’un système cryptographique afin d’obtenir les connaissances nécessaires pour briser ou contourner la protection que le système est conçu pour fournir. En d’autres termes, il s’agit de convertir le texte chiffré en texte clair sans connaître la clé.
Origines et Histoire
La cryptanalyse a des racines anciennes et a joué un rôle crucial à de nombreuses époques historiques. De la Grèce antique, avec la célèbre scytale spartiate, en passant par le Moyen Âge avec le chiffrement de César, jusqu’aux temps modernes avec l’utilisation intensive durant les guerres mondiales, la cryptanalyse a toujours été une discipline fondamentale dans la protection et l’interception des communications.
Principes Fondamentaux
À la base de la cryptanalyse, on trouve plusieurs principes et techniques, notamment :
- Analyse fréquentielle : Elle repose sur l’observation que dans chaque langue, certaines lettres apparaissent plus fréquemment que d’autres. Par exemple, en français, la lettre “E” est très courante. En comparant la fréquence des lettres dans le texte chiffré avec celles typiques de la langue, il est possible d’émettre des hypothèses sur les substitutions utilisées.
- Cryptanalyse différentielle : Une technique avancée qui cherche à identifier les différences entre les textes chiffrés obtenus à partir de clés légèrement différentes. Cette méthode est particulièrement utile contre les algorithmes de chiffrement par bloc.
- Attaques par force brute : Tentative de déchiffrer le texte chiffré en essayant toutes les clés possibles. Bien qu’il s’agisse d’une méthode coûteuse en temps et en ressources, avec l’augmentation de la puissance de calcul, cela reste une technique viable pour les clés plus faibles.
- Attaques basées sur des connaissances partielles : Elles utilisent des informations supplémentaires que l’attaquant pourrait posséder, comme des fragments de texte en clair ou certaines caractéristiques du message original.
Exemples de Cryptanalyse Historique
Un exemple célèbre de cryptanalyse est le travail accompli durant la Seconde Guerre mondiale pour déchiffrer les messages codés avec la machine Enigma utilisée par les nazis. Le travail d’Alan Turing et de son équipe à Bletchley Park fut déterminant pour briser ce système cryptographique complexe, contribuant de manière significative à la victoire des Alliés.
Applications Modernes
Aujourd’hui, la cryptanalyse est plus importante que jamais dans le contexte de la cybersécurité. Elle est utilisée non seulement pour évaluer et améliorer la sécurité des systèmes cryptographiques, mais aussi pour identifier des vulnérabilités dans des algorithmes que l’on pensait sûrs. Avec l’avènement de la cryptographie quantique et d’autres technologies avancées, la cryptanalyse continue d’évoluer, conservant son rôle crucial dans la protection des informations sensibles.
Conclusion
La cryptanalyse demeure une discipline essentielle dans la lutte pour la sécurité des communications. Grâce à des techniques de plus en plus sophistiquées et à l’évolution de la technologie, elle continue de représenter un champ de recherche dynamique et fondamental pour la protection des données dans un monde de plus en plus numérique.
Leave a Reply